Kargil Apricot Harvest Expedition Witness one of the world's rarest harvest seasons For just a few weeks each year, Kargil transforms into a sea of golden-orange apricots. Remarkably, this spectacular apricot harvest takes place on a commercial scale in only two regions of the world—parts of Canada and the Kargil region of Ladakh, India. This limited-season journey combines breathtaking Himalayan landscapes, rich history, authentic Balti culture, and the unique opportunity to experience the harvest at its peak. From the lush meadows of Sonamarg to the dramatic mountains of Kargil, this expedition is designed for travelers seeking experiences beyond the ordinary.
